Once the powders are mixed, the next step involves shaping these glowing mixtures into beads. This is done using specialized molds that come in various sizes and shapes, providing endless possibilities for creativity. As the mixture is poured into the molds, it is left to cure, allowing it to harden while retaining the phosphorescent properties. In this stage, precision is key — even the slightest variation in mixture or curing time can result in beads that don’t glow as brightly or for as long as intended.

While the beads are curing, the factory team works tirelessly to ensure quality control. Each batch undergoes rigorous testing, with samples taken to verify their glow intensity and longevity. This attention to detail is what differentiates high-quality glow-in-the-dark beads from ordinary ones. Once a batch passes inspection, it is time to add the finishing touches.
